Output 865e6686409fdf08983b7fe085a86ee089ba2461f61635a30e9de62289e68b9a:1

value
9425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5751670cf5644d54a06ded455bd304cb9aaf19d3 OP_EQUALVERIFY OP_CHECKSIG
address
18xhJdwpF1k1Mhtfc19SgSGPMXBfDaohcE
transaction
865e6686409fdf08983b7fe085a86ee089ba2461f61635a30e9de62289e68b9a
confirmations
514821
spent
true